1. Purpose

The purpose of this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) is to establish a systematic process for assembling equipment used in ointment manufacturing. Proper assembly ensures that equipment functions optimally, maintains GMP compliance, and prevents cross-contamination.

2. Scope

This SOP applies to all personnel responsible for assembling equipment such as mixing tanks, homogenizers, heating vessels, and filling machines in the ointment manufacturing area.

3. Responsibilities

  • Production Supervisor: Ensures that all equipment is assembled correctly before manufacturing starts.
  • Maintenance Engineer: Assembles and verifies proper functioning of equipment.
  • Quality Assurance (QA) Officer: Conducts final inspection and approves equipment readiness.
  • Operators: Assist in assembling equipment components and ensure adherence to cleaning procedures.

4. Accountability

The Production and Engineering Managers are accountable for ensuring that all equipment is assembled correctly, documented, and verified as per GMP standards.

5. Procedure

5.1 Pre-Assembly Checks

  • Ensure that all equipment components are clean, dry, and free from residues.
  • Verify that all required tools and gaskets are available for assembly.
  • Check the equipment calibration status and ensure it is up to date.

5.2 Assembling Mixing Tanks

  • Position the mixing tank in its designated location.
  • Attach
the mixing blades securely and ensure they rotate freely.
  • Connect the required hoses and valves for material transfer.
  • Tighten all clamps and seals to prevent leaks.
  • 5.3 Assembling Homogenizer

    • Install the homogenizer shaft and impellers as per manufacturer guidelines.
    • Ensure the homogenization chamber is securely locked in place.
    • Check motor alignment and lubrication.
    • Verify that safety interlocks are functional.

    5.4 Assembling Heating and Melting Vessels

    • Attach the heating elements and temperature sensors.
    • Connect the steam or electrical supply for heating.
    • Check for leaks in heating coils and temperature control systems.

    5.5 Assembling Filling Machine

    • Install filling nozzles and secure them firmly.
    • Calibrate filling volume settings as per batch requirements.
    • Check the movement of piston pumps or peristaltic pumps.
    • Test the conveyor system and ensure smooth movement.

    5.6 Equipment Verification

    • Conduct a dry run to check the functionality of each component.
    • Verify that all safety interlocks and emergency stops are working.
    • QA personnel must perform a final inspection and approve the assembly.

    5.7 Documentation and Approval

    • Record all assembly steps in the Equipment Assembly Log.
    • Obtain QA approval before starting manufacturing.
    • Label assembled equipment as “Ready for Use.”
